How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Revere?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Revere Studio Apartments | $2,498 | $1,495 | $10,000+ |
| Revere 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,714 | $1,200 | $10,000+ |
Revere 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,394 | $1,400 | $10,000+ |
| Revere 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,686 | $2,000 | $6,409 |
| Revere 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,513 | $2,695 | $4,800 |
| Revere 5 Bedroom Apartments | $4,609 | $3,500 | $6,000 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 2 Bedroom Revere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Revere with 2 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 2 Bedroom in Revere is at Pratt Place Apartments listed at $2,299.
How much is the average rent for a 2 Bedroom Revere Apartment?
The average rent for a 2 Bedroom Apartment in Revere is $3,394.
What is the largest available 2 Bedroom Revere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Revere is a 2,162 square feet unit starting from $7,895 at The Robinson.
What is the average size for Revere 2 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 2 Bedroom rental in Revere is currently 1,481 sq ft.
